
ACLU of New Mexico Director of Public Policy Steven Robert Allen said he views the upcoming legislative session as a once-in-a-generation opportunity to move what he describes as the cause of liberty forward in New Mexico.
He cited a new governor and shake-ups in the legislature as opportunities to pass ACLU-supported legislation which he says will protect and extend freedoms.
Allen said the trainings are designed to give people tools to have powerful and productive conversations with legislators, and to connect to resources and a network of activists engaged in like-minded efforts.
